This is a great lighter at lower elevations, above 5500' not so much. Reason for 4 stars, can't complain as the company says it doesn't work that well above 5000', so I knew that before purchase. The sliding ignition button is a pain but manageable. Extended, the flame head makes it easy to light a stove or fire without burning your fingers. Smaller form factor than a BBQ lighter and refillable is a plus. Get the SOTO refill adapter to use a ISO canister. Time will tell the pros and cons.

It's smaller than a disposable BBQ lighter and works much more reliably. Not that much bigger than a BIC lighter, and the extension means that you don't burn your fingers. Since it's refillable it will be cheaper in the long run, too. You CAN refill it from a regular 8 oz butane fuel cartridge (the tall cylindrical one, not the squatty camping stove one), without the adapter. Turn the cartridge upside down, insert the nozzle in the hole, and press. The little window on the side shows when the lighter is full.

Great lighter but returning it. At 5000 ft it works well enough that I almost kept it but at higher elevations not so much. It did not work at all at 8500 ft. so not a good backpacking or emergency solution for me.
